Hope & Braim are delighted to present 2 Mill Court, Ruswarp.
Perfectly suited for investors or first-time buyers, this charming apartment is set within a Grade II listed 18th-century water mill, converted in the early 1990s into a small, characterful development of apartments and cottages by a local builder.
Located in the sought-after village of Ruswarp, just one mile from the popular seaside town of Whitby, the property enjoys a tranquil riverside position beside the River Esk — a rare find with excellent lifestyle and rental appeal.
The apartment is spread over three levels and accessed via a secure communal entrance with a telephone entry system. The main floor features an open-plan lounge and kitchen area, along with a modern three-piece bathroom Upstairs, the double bedroom benefits from fitted wardrobes and two Velux windows for plenty of natural light. On the lower ground floor, a versatile space is currently used as a dining area or second lounge, offering picturesque river views.
With its historic charm, scenic location, and close proximity to Whitby, this property offers an excellent opportunity for buyers seeking a unique home or a strong addition to their investment portfolio.
